Michael Miller's poems focus on the intimacies and complexities of love, family, waking life, and "the space between dreams." He continues to show in another insightful book his mastery of the human voice and heart.

SLEEVE
In the rear-view mirror
They vanish, the maples
With ice-coated branches
Drawing me back to the magicians
Of childhood who made things
Appear, disappear,
Their top hats and wands
Vivid in the long mirror
Of memory. Innocence still
Lives inside me, silent as
The space between dreams,
Waiting to be pulled out
Of a sleeve, its white wings
Fluttering into the air.
